Bromeliaceae 22 Sept/Oct 2008 A Quick Guide to Bromeliad Problems (by Peniel Romanelli) Editorial Comment (Bob Reilly). Trouble-shooting guides are always popular, and this article, prepared by a grower in the southern part of the United States of America, deals with many of the problems encountered by bromeliad growers. Reprinted, with permission, from the Journal of The Bromeliad Society, 1996, v 46 (4), pp 182 M 183. Most bromeliads are fairly trouble-free, but problems do crop up. Some of the more common ones, along with some possible causes are listed below. Problem Likely Causes Pale, bleached appear- Too much sun ance Poor colour Too much shade

Long, floppy leaves Too much shade Brown or yellow leaf Plant grown too dry ends or edges Cold or heat damage Poor ventilation Mix or water has wrong Ph (most bromeliads like an acidic mix) Brown spots Watering in full sun Too much light Cold or heat damage Chemical burns (possibly caused by copper or arsenic from treated wood or misuse of pesticides. Never use oil based pesticides or those containing copper or arsenic Quilling (inner leaves Little or no water in cup stick together) Brown or mushy leaves OWet feetP as a result of over watering, potting too deep, or bad at base drainage Holes in leaves Snails, slugs, insects Watering in full sun Center leaves loose, Crown rot; possibly a result of stagnant water or poor ventila- withered brown, or tion whitish and soft, with a smell that would choke a buzzard Crown rot can be treated by pulling out the loose leaves, thoroughly rinsing the cup with!clean!water,!and![lling!the!cup!with!a!good!systemic!fungicide!for!about!1!hour.!!Drain,! let!the!plant!dry!overnight,!then!re[ll!with!clean!water.!!The!plant!probably!wonRt!bloom,! but you should get pups.
